Output 53e1963f19caf74efa823aad45fb3b28e63d046784f260e83023a2145dac6546:0

value
138600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ab2c33e7698e759a80b4fdedb4a1b16abd63e6d8 OP_EQUAL
address
3HJ6RcCQdxbiAqdn554XogMHwaaiDhy5Aa
transaction
53e1963f19caf74efa823aad45fb3b28e63d046784f260e83023a2145dac6546
spent
true